180gm Vinyl. Brooklyn-born 'Little Anthony and the Imperials' were one of the first black vocal groups to achieve great success on the rock 'n' roll charts. Such hits as Tears On My Pillow, #4 in October 1958 and Shimmy, Shimmy, Ko-Ko Bop, #24 in February 1960 helped to establish the unique appeal of this singing quartet. This collection of their best songs on 180g Vinyl also includes the chart hits So Much and A Prayer And A Jukebox.
